Lease Extension Services and Costs
If you would like Pro-Leagle to manage the Leasehold extension process for you, here is a breakdown of our charges:
First Stage
Eligibility Assessment to extend your Lease (flats and houses)
- This service provides confirmation of whether you qualify for Lease Extension as set our in the Leasehold Reform, Housing and Urban Development Act 1993 and the Commonhold and Leasehold Reform Act 2002. If you are not eligible, we will refund the charge less £5.00 administrative fee.
Cost: £94.00 inc. VAT together with £15.00 disbursements).
Second Stage
Initial Valuation of Lease Extension
- This service provides a estimate of how much you should be paying your freeholder for a lease extension. You will receive a comprehensive Initial Valuation Report detailing what issues will affect the value of your lease extension, such as Marriage Value.
- The Valuation itself is based on the number of years remaining on your Lease, the current value of your flat and the Yield Rate and Percentage Improvement in Value for your locality. These values were collated from determinations of the Leasehold Valuation Tribunal for areas throughout the United Kingdom.

Third Stage
Management of the Leasehold Extension process
- To consider your lease and supporting documentation and, if necessary, request further information from your freeholder, including intermediary leases, service charge records or surveys.
- To appoint a professional surveyor to value your leasehold extension, unless the purchase price is already agreed. Following this, to consider the surveyor's valuation and agree negotiation criteria for best purchase price.
- To draft and serve a Notice on your freehold owner setting out your request to extend your lease by ninety years, as per statutory guidelines.
- To deal with any correspondence from your freehold owner for further information and consider and discuss the freeholder's final response.
- If the Freeholder is unwilling to negotiate a leasehold extension, to discuss with you an application to the Leasehold Valuation Tribunal to compel lease extension, as per statutory guidelines, including the Commonhold and Leasehold Reform Act 2002. If such an application is required, Pro-Leagle can assist you at additional cost.
- All updates are provided to you throughout the process.
